This is the recursive formula of that sequence: WebFind the first term a_1 and the common difference d. Then you can get the other formula quite easily. Ex.) Find the recursive formula if the explicit formula is a_n = 5n - 3. Let's find a_1 and d. a_1 = 5 * 1 - 3 = 2 d = a_(n + 1) - a_n = 5(n + 1) - 3 - 5n + 3 = 5 Recursive formula: a_1 = 2 a_n = a_(n - 1) + 5, where n = 2, 3, 4,...

WebFor example, you have the recursive formula: g (1)=9 g (x)=g (x-1)* (8) 9 is the first term of the sequence, and 8 is the common ratio. An explicit formula is structured as: g (x)= (1st term of seq.)* (common ratio)^ (x-1) Substitute for the variables, and you get the explicit formula: g (x)= 9*8^ (x-1) And there you have it!
